About Wainbee Limited
Wainbee Limited is a solutions provider in engineered systems, products and services for Motion & Control, Filtration and Automation Solutions. By partnering with customers across a multitude of markets we are able to design new or enhance existing systems. As one of Canada's largest privately held distributors, Wainbee Limited has 14 offices and over 200 employees; including a team of engineering staff coast to coast.
Market demands for specialized services has allowed Wainbee Limited to enhance our offerings from our original industrial fluid power base to becoming your complete Motion & Control, Filtration and Automation products and services provider. As an employee owned company, incorporated in the 1950's Wainbee Limited has become your trusted partner and solutions provider.
